For two more, in fact. Paramount announced that the series had been renewed for a 4th and 5th season back in June. The fifth season is slated to be the show's last, similar to what was already done with Lower Decks and Discovery. It has also been indicated that the final season will be shorter, comprising only six episodes instead of ten. They announced a day or two ago that season 5 is going to be shorter than the others, with just six episodes. Apparently Paramount originally wanted to end on a movie, but showrunners pushed to continue the episodic format. There is a little bit of speculation that the short season five is another case of robbing Peter to pay Paul, diverting funding to the Starfleet Academy series.

Talked my lady into watching Warfare since everyone seems to be bringing it up lately since it dropped on Max or HBO Max or whatever it’s called now. I personally liked it, but not quite as much as others and my lady although liking war movies didn’t really like it at all. I think the issue is that while the action is done really well, it’s bit light on story. Or maybe that it isn’t so much a story, but an experience. It probably could’ve helped to have a bit of exposition about what was going on and maybe could have been a bit easier to get a feel for things if they showed some of the film from the other groups involved. Overall, I personally liked it, but I feel like it will be more enjoyed from guys that dig action or military folk than the average person.

Volks 1:144 KOG D Mirage test fit is moving fast. Just need to get the arms/shoulders, and bow trimmed/built. There are few seams that I will actually need to fix which is amazing and speeds things up considerably. I’m not concerned about all of the hidden seams/details on the frame that the armor will cover up in final assembly. The fit is great! The IMS line has come a long ways. The smaller scale packs in detail and is perfect for my limited space. The scale feels a little larger than their others in the line but not too bad. Here’s a pic of the KOG No.7 in the line with Batsh which was No.1 in the line.
